Patents by Inventor Dominik A. Slezak

Dominik A. Slezak has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Publication number: 20240080566
    Abstract: At least one system and method herein are for camera handling in live environments. This includes determining a musical score to be performed in the live environment, analyzing a live version of the musical score with the recorded version of the musical score in a live environment, where the analysis is to determine a time-based difference of at least one frame in the live version against the recorded version, and where the time-based difference is to be used, along with at least one predominant effect of the recorded version or the live version, to enable camera selection or camera adjustments of one or more cameras in the live environment.
    Type: Application
    Filed: September 1, 2023
    Publication date: March 7, 2024
    Applicant: OnstageAI, INC.
    Inventors: Jakub Fiebig, Adam Borowski, Dominik Slezak, Andrzej Bukala, Pawel Kowaleczko, Zuzanna Kwiatkowska, Jan Ludziejewski, Andzelika Zalewska
  • Patent number: 11301467
    Abstract: Embodiments may provide methods and systems for intelligent capture and fast transformation of granulated data summaries. An engine may be used to transform input data summaries into result sets representing query outcomes. The data summaries contain enough knowledge about the original data to accurately perform operations on the summaries without needing to access the original data. In an embodiment, the contents of data summaries are accessible via an SQL approximate engine which retrieves summaries stored on disk and utilizes them for its operations. Alternatively, the contents of data summaries are accessible via virtual tables which give users direct access to the summary contents and allow for the creation and implementation of algorithms to work with the data summaries independently from the SQL approximate engine.
    Type: Grant
    Filed: July 1, 2019
    Date of Patent: April 12, 2022
    Assignee: Security On-Demand, Inc.
    Inventors: Dominik Slezak, Richard Glick, Pawel Betlinski, Piotr Synak, Jakub Wroblewski, Agnieszka Chadzynska-Krasowska, Janusz Borkowski, Arkadiusz Wojna, Joel Alan Holland
  • Publication number: 20200004749
    Abstract: Embodiments may provide methods and systems for intelligent capture and fast transformation of granulated data summaries. An engine may be used to transform input data summaries into result sets representing query outcomes. The data summaries contain enough knowledge about the original data to accurately perform operations on the summaries without needing to access the original data. In an embodiment, the contents of data summaries are accessible via an SQL approximate engine which retrieves summaries stored on disk and utilizes them for its operations. Alternatively, the contents of data summaries are accessible via virtual tables which give users direct access to the summary contents and allow for the creation and implementation of algorithms to work with the data summaries independently from the SQL approximate engine.
    Type: Application
    Filed: July 1, 2019
    Publication date: January 2, 2020
    Inventors: Dominik Slezak, Richard Glick, Pawel Betlinkski, Piotr Synak, Jakub Wroblewski, Agnieszka Chadzynska-Krasowska, Janusz Borkowski, Arkadiusz Wojna, Joel Alan Holland
  • Publication number: 20150088807
    Abstract: A method of resolving data queries in a data processing system. The method comprises receiving in the data processing system a data query, where the data processing system stores a plurality of information units describing pluralities of data elements, a first information unit having a retrieval subunit that includes information for retrieving all unique data elements in a first plurality of data elements and a summary subunit including summarized information about data elements in the first plurality of data elements. The method further includes deriving, via the data processing system, a result of the data query, wherein the result of the data query comprises a plurality of new data elements. The data processing system uses summary subunits of information units to select a set of information units describing data elements that are sufficient to resolve the data query.
    Type: Application
    Filed: September 25, 2014
    Publication date: March 26, 2015
    Inventors: Graham Toppin, Janusz Borkowksi, Dominik Slezak, Shengli Shi, Piotr Synak, Jakub Wroblewski, Todd Joseph Wongkee, George Charalabopoulos
  • Patent number: 8943100
    Abstract: In a method for storing data in a relational database system using a processor, a collection of values is assigned to a structure dictionary, each of the values represents the value of a row for an attribute and has a unique ordinal number within the collection. and the structure dictionary contains structures defined based on at least one of interaction with a user of the system via an interface, automatic detection of structures occurring in data, automatic detection of frequencies of values occurring in data, analysis of a history of queries, and predetermined information about structures relevant to data content that is stored in the system. For each structure, forming a structure match list from ordinal numbers of values matching the structure, and a structure sub-collection from values matching the structure, using the processor.
    Type: Grant
    Filed: March 13, 2013
    Date of Patent: January 27, 2015
    Assignee: Infobright Inc.
    Inventors: Dominik Slezak, Graham Toppin, Marcin Kowalski, Arkadiusz Wojna
  • Publication number: 20150006508
    Abstract: A method comprises grouping, via a data processing system, a plurality of data elements in a same data type into a plurality of data units. The method further comprises gathering, via the data processing system, information about data elements in a first data unit into a first information unit. The first information unit comprising a representation of information that is less than all unique information in the first data unit. The method also comprises storing, via the data processing system, the first information unit on a computer readable storage device. The method additionally comprises identifying, via the data processing system, based at least in part on the first information unit, whether the data elements in the first data unit are required to be retrieved to resolve a first data query received by the data processing system and to resolve the first data query.
    Type: Application
    Filed: September 12, 2014
    Publication date: January 1, 2015
    Inventors: Dominik A. Slezak, Kazimierz Apanowicz, Victoria K. Eastwood, Piotr D. Synak, Arkadiusz G. Wojna, Marcin Wojnarski, Jakub Z. Wroblewski
  • Publication number: 20140337315
    Abstract: A system and method of processing a data query in a data processing system is provided. The data in the data processing system includes a plurality of individual data elements. The data elements are grouped and stored in at least one data unit. The information about the at least one data unit is gathered and stored in at least one information unit. The method comprises receiving the data query to be executed; using the information in the at least one information unit to optimize and execute the query; resolving the data query; and returning results of the data query for use by the data processing system.
    Type: Application
    Filed: July 24, 2014
    Publication date: November 13, 2014
    Inventors: Dominik A. Slezak, Kazimierz Apanowicz, Victoria K. Eastwood, Piotr D. Synak, Arkadiusz G. Wojna, Marcin Wojnarski, Jakub Z. Wroblewski
  • Patent number: 8838593
    Abstract: A system and method of processing a data query in a data processing system is provided. The data in the data processing system includes a plurality of individual data elements. The data elements are grouped and stored in at least one data unit. The information about the at least one data unit is gathered and stored in at least one information unit. The method comprises receiving the data query to be executed; using the information in the at least one information unit to optimize and execute the query; resolving the data query; and returning results of the data query for use by the data processing system.
    Type: Grant
    Filed: September 13, 2007
    Date of Patent: September 16, 2014
    Assignee: Infobright Inc.
    Inventors: Cas Kazimierz Apanowicz, Victoria K. Eastwood, Dominik A. Slezak, Piotr D. Synak, Arkadiusz G. Wojna, Marcin Wojnarski, Jakub Z. Wroblewski
  • Publication number: 20140229454
    Abstract: A method for applying adaptive data compression in a relational database system using a filter cascade having at least one compression filter stage in the filter cascade. The method comprises applying a data filter associated with the compression filter stage to the data input to produce reconstruction information and filtered data, then compressing the reconstruction information to be included in a filter stream. The filtered data is provided as a compression filter stage output. The method may comprise evaluating whether the compression filter stage provides improved compression compared to the data input. The filter stage output may be used as the input of a subsequent compression filter stage.
    Type: Application
    Filed: April 15, 2014
    Publication date: August 14, 2014
    Applicant: Infobright Inc.
    Inventors: Dominik A. Slezak, Kazimierz Apanowicz, Victoria K. Eastwood, Piotr D. Synak, Arkadiusz G. Wojna, Marcin Wojnarski, Jakub Z. Wroblewski
  • Patent number: 8700579
    Abstract: A method for applying adaptive data compression in a relational database system using a filter cascade having at least one compression filter stage in the filter cascade. The method comprises applying a data filter associated with the compression filter stage to the data input to produce reconstruction information and filtered data, then compressing the reconstruction information to be included in a filter stream. The filtered data is provided as a compression filter stage output. The method may comprise evaluating whether the compression filter stage provides improved compression compared to the data input. The filter stage output may be used as the input of a subsequent compression filter stage.
    Type: Grant
    Filed: August 22, 2007
    Date of Patent: April 15, 2014
    Assignee: Infobright Inc.
    Inventors: Cas Kazimierz Apanowicz, Victoria K. Eastwood, Dominik A. Slezak, Piotr D. Synak, Arkadiusz G. Wojna, Marcin Wojnarski, Jakub Z. Wroblewski
  • Patent number: 8521748
    Abstract: In a method for managing metadata in a relational database system using a processor, the metadata is created in a form of rough values corresponding to collections of values, wherein each rough value represents summarized information about values, the values are elements of the corresponding collection of values, and each rough value is substantially smaller than the corresponding collection of values. A collection of values is assigned to a structure dictionary, wherein each of the values represents the value of a row for an attribute and has a unique ordinal number within the collection, and wherein the structure dictionary contains structures defined based on at least one of interaction with a user of the system via an interface, automatic detection of structures occurring in data, and predetermined information about structures relevant to data content that is stored in the system. A match granule is formed, and for each structure in the structure dictionary, a structure granule is formed.
    Type: Grant
    Filed: June 14, 2011
    Date of Patent: August 27, 2013
    Assignee: Infobright Inc.
    Inventors: Dominik Slezak, Graham Toppin, Marcin Kowalski, Arkadiusz Wojna
  • Patent number: 8417727
    Abstract: In a method for storing data in a relational database system using a processor, a collection of values is assigned to a structure dictionary, wherein each of the values represents the value of a row for an attribute and has a unique ordinal number within the collection, and wherein the structure dictionary contains structures defined based on at least one of interaction with a user of the system via an interface, automatic detection of structures occurring in data, and predetermined information about structures relevant to data content that is stored in the system. For each structure in the structure dictionary, a structure match list is formed from ordinal numbers of values matching the structure, and a structure sub-collection from values matching the structure, using the processor.
    Type: Grant
    Filed: June 14, 2011
    Date of Patent: April 9, 2013
    Assignee: Infobright Inc.
    Inventors: Dominik Slezak, Graham Toppin, Marcin Kowalski, Arkadiusz Wojna
  • Patent number: 8266147
    Abstract: A relational database having a plurality of records is organized by using a processing arrangement to perform a clustering operation on the records so as to create a number of clusters. At least one of the clusters is characterized by a selected metadata parameter. The clustering operation is performed to optimize a calculated value of a selected precision factor for the selected metadata parameter. The selected metadata parameter is selected to optimize execution of a database query and the value of the selected precision factor is related to efficiency of execution of the database query.
    Type: Grant
    Filed: November 26, 2008
    Date of Patent: September 11, 2012
    Assignee: Infobright, Inc.
    Inventors: Dominik Slezak, Marcin Kowalski, Victoria Eastwood, Jakub Wroblewski
  • Publication number: 20110307472
    Abstract: In a method for storing data in a relational database system using a processor, a collection of values is assigned to a structure dictionary, wherein each of the values represents the value of a row for an attribute and has a unique ordinal number within the collection, and wherein the structure dictionary contains structures defined based on at least one of interaction with a user of the system via an interface, automatic detection of structures occurring in data, and predetermined information about structures relevant to data content that is stored in the system. For each structure in the structure dictionary, a structure match list is formed from ordinal numbers of values matching the structure, and a structure sub-collection from values matching the structure, using the processor.
    Type: Application
    Filed: June 14, 2011
    Publication date: December 15, 2011
    Applicant: INFOBRIGHT, INC.
    Inventors: Dominik Slezak, Graham Toppin, Marcin Kowalski, Arkadiusz Wojna
  • Publication number: 20110307521
    Abstract: In a method for storing data in a relational database system using a processor, a collection of values is assigned to a structure dictionary, wherein each of the values represents the value of a row for an attribute and has a unique ordinal number within the collection, and wherein the structure dictionary contains structures defined based on at least one of interaction with a user of the system via an interface, automatic detection of structures occurring in data, and predetermined information about structures relevant to data content that is stored in the system. For each structure in the structure dictionary, a structure match list is formed from ordinal numbers of values matching the structure, and a structure sub-collection from values matching the structure, using the processor.
    Type: Application
    Filed: June 14, 2011
    Publication date: December 15, 2011
    Applicant: INFOBRIGHT, INC.
    Inventors: Dominik Slezak, Graham Toppin, Marcin Kowalski, Arkadiusz Wojna
  • Publication number: 20090106210
    Abstract: A relational database having a plurality of records is organized by using a processing arrangement to perform a clustering operation on the records so as to create a number of clusters. At least one of the clusters is characterized by a selected metadata parameter. The clustering operation is performed to optimize a calculated value of a selected precision factor for the selected metadata parameter. The selected metadata parameter is selected to optimize execution of a database query and the value of the selected precision factor is related to efficiency of execution of the database query.
    Type: Application
    Filed: November 26, 2008
    Publication date: April 23, 2009
    Applicant: Infobright, Inc.
    Inventors: Dominik Slezak, Marcin Kowalski, Victoria Eastwood, Jakub Wroblewski
  • Publication number: 20080071748
    Abstract: A system and method of processing a data query in a data processing system is provided. The data in the data processing system includes a plurality of individual data elements. The data elements are grouped and stored in at least one data unit. The information about the at least one data unit is gathered and stored in at least one information unit. The method comprises receiving the data query to be executed; using the information in the at least one information unit to optimize and execute the query; resolving the data query; and returning results of the data query for use by the data processing system.
    Type: Application
    Filed: September 13, 2007
    Publication date: March 20, 2008
    Applicant: INFOBRIGHT INC.
    Inventors: Jakub Z. Wroblewski, Cas (Kazimierz) Apanowicz, Victoria K. Eastwood, Dominik A. Slezak, Piotr D. Synak, Arkadiusz G. Wojna, Marcin Wojnarski
  • Publication number: 20080071818
    Abstract: A method for applying adaptive data compression in a relational database system using a filter cascade having at least one compression filter stage in the filter cascade. The method comprises applying a data filter associated with the compression filter stage to the data input to produce reconstruction information and filtered data, then compressing the reconstruction information to be included in a filter stream. The filtered data is provided as a compression filter stage output. The method may comprise evaluating whether the compression filter stage provides improved compression compared to the data input. The filter stage output may be used as the input of a subsequent compression filter stage.
    Type: Application
    Filed: August 22, 2007
    Publication date: March 20, 2008
    Applicant: INFOBRIGHT INC.
    Inventors: Cas (Kazimierz) Apanowicz, Victoria K. Eastwood, Dominik A. Slezak, Piotr D. Synak, Arkadiusz G. Wojna, Marcin Wojnarski, Jakub Z. Wroblewski